Wastewater systems are important framework elements that play a critical function in managing secondhand water from property, industrial, and farming sources. These systems are created to collect, reward, transportation, and discharge wastewater, guaranteeing that it is refined efficiently prior to coming back the environment. The main elements of a wastewater system consist of collection networks, therapy facilities, and discharge systems.Collection networks typically include a series of pipes and pumping terminals that collect wastewater from different resources and direct it to treatment centers. Therapy facilities are geared up with innovative innovations that get rid of microorganisms and contaminants, changing polluted water right into a cleaner state suitable for release or reuse. This process usually involves several stages, consisting of initial, key, secondary, and in some cases tertiary treatment, each created to resolve specific contaminants.
The final stage of a wastewater system includes the secure discharge or recycling of treated water, which can be returned to natural water bodies or repurposed for irrigation and industrial procedures. By effectively handling wastewater, these systems not just secure public wellness and the setting yet additionally add to the sustainable use of water resources, making them important in contemporary facilities.
Ecological Influences of Poor Monitoring
The repercussions of insufficient wastewater management can be extensive, causing considerable environmental destruction. Inadequately handled wastewater systems frequently result in the contamination of neighborhood water bodies, presenting damaging pollutants such as hefty steels, pathogens, and nutrients. This contamination can interfere with water communities, resulting in reduced biodiversity and the decrease of sensitive varieties.Additionally, untreated or improperly treated wastewater can add to eutrophication, a procedure where excess nutrients stimulate algal flowers. These flowers diminish oxygen degrees in the water, creating dead areas that are inhospitable to most aquatic life. Furthermore, the visibility of microorganisms in neglected wastewater poses major public wellness dangers, possibly bring about waterborne illness that impact both animal and human populations.
Dirt contamination is one more vital concern, as leachate from incorrectly taken care of wastewater can infiltrate groundwater materials, compromising alcohol consumption water quality. Cutting-edge Technologies in Wastewater Treatment
Innovations in ingenious modern technologies are changing wastewater treatment procedures, aligning with the objectives of sustainability and efficiency. These innovations incorporate a series of approaches designed to improve the therapy process while lessening environmental effect. One significant development is the execution of membrane layer bioreactors (MBRs), which combine organic treatment with membrane layer filtering, resulting in high-grade effluent and lowered energy usage.
In addition, the development of decentralized therapy systems provides adaptable services for areas, minimizing the need for substantial infrastructure and advertising source recovery with nutrient recycling.
